摘要: 从采自西藏的皱叶香茶菜中分离鉴定了3对B-闭联对映贝壳杉烯型二萜化合物:二萜化合物皱叶香茶菜素(Ⅰ)和二氢皱叶香茶菜素(Ⅱ);isodocarpin(Ⅲ)和dihydroisodocarpin(Ⅳ)及Carpalasionin(Ⅴ)和dihydrocarpalasionin(Ⅵ)。(Ⅰ)、(Ⅲ)和(Ⅴ)分别与对应的二氢化合物(Ⅱ)、(Ⅳ)和(Ⅵ)以混合物的形式被分离和鉴定。化合物(Ⅱ)为新化合物,(Ⅰ)、(Ⅳ)和(Ⅵ)首次在自然界发现,(Ⅲ)和(Ⅴ)为已知化合物。

Abstract: Three pairs of B-seco-ent-kaurene type diterpenoids were isolated from Rabdosia rugosa (Wall. )Hara collected from Tibet, and the structures of them were elucidated. They are diterpenoids rugosanin(Ⅰ ) and dihydrorugosanin (Ⅱ ), isodocarpin( Ⅲ ) and dihydroisodocarpin (Ⅳ ), carpala-sionin(Ⅴ) and dihydrocarpalasionin (Ⅵ). ( Ⅰ ), (Ⅲ) and (Ⅴ) were isolated, respectively, in the. form of mixtures with their corresponding dihydrocompounds ( Ⅱ ), (Ⅳ ) and ( Ⅵ ). The structure identification was based on the mixtures of each pair. Diterpenoid (Ⅱ ) is a new compound; ( Ⅰ ), (Ⅳ ) and ( Ⅵ) are for the first time found in nature, ( Ⅲ ) and ( Ⅴ ) are known compounds.
